// Licensed to the .NET Foundation under one or more agreements. // The .NET Foundation licenses this file to you under the MIT license. using System; using System.Threading; using System.Threading.Tasks; using Xunit; namespace Microsoft.Extensions.AI; public class ConfigureOptionsEmbeddingGeneratorTests { [Fact] public void ConfigureOptionsEmbeddingGenerator_InvalidArgs_Throws() { Assert.Throws<ArgumentNullException>("innerGenerator", () => new ConfigureOptionsEmbeddingGenerator<string, Embedding<float>>(null!, _ => { })); Assert.Throws<ArgumentNullException>("configure", () => new ConfigureOptionsEmbeddingGenerator<string, Embedding<float>>(new TestEmbeddingGenerator(), null!)); } [Fact] public void ConfigureOptions_InvalidArgs_Throws() { using var innerGenerator = new TestEmbeddingGenerator(); var builder = innerGenerator.AsBuilder(); Assert.Throws<ArgumentNullException>("configure", () => builder.ConfigureOptions(null!)); } [Theory] [InlineData(false)] [InlineData(true)] public async Task ConfigureOptions_ReturnedInstancePassedToNextClient(bool nullProvidedOptions) { EmbeddingGenerationOptions? providedOptions = nullProvidedOptions ? null : new() { ModelId = "test" }; EmbeddingGenerationOptions? returnedOptions = null; GeneratedEmbeddings<Embedding<float>> expectedEmbeddings = []; using CancellationTokenSource cts = new(); using IEmbeddingGenerator<string, Embedding<float>> innerGenerator = new TestEmbeddingGenerator { GenerateAsyncCallback = (inputs, options, cancellationToken) => { Assert.Same(returnedOptions, options); Assert.Equal(cts.Token, cancellationToken); return Task.FromResult(expectedEmbeddings); } }; using var generator = innerGenerator .AsBuilder() .ConfigureOptions(options => { Assert.NotSame(providedOptions, options); if (nullProvidedOptions) { Assert.Null(options.ModelId); } else { Assert.Equal(providedOptions!.ModelId, options.ModelId); } returnedOptions = options; }) .Build(); var embeddings = await generator.GenerateAsync([], providedOptions, cts.Token); Assert.Same(expectedEmbeddings, embeddings); } }
